Civil Engineering knowledge with relevant experience in suitable disciplines (Experience in Rail infrastructure to include Electrification is required).
Previous experience working for a tier one contracting group operating in civil engineering.
An excellent understanding in applying planning software to create clear, comprehensible and realistic programmes.
Knowledge of planning software (such as MS-Project, Asta Powerproject or P6 Primavera).
Completion of courses relevant to a career in planning.
Understanding of construction design.
A related degree, diploma, or vocational qualification, or equivalent demonstrable experience in Civil Engineering.
The ability to plan from first principles.
Excellent communication skills, both verbal and written.
Good level of NEC4 knowledge, and knowledge of how it should be applied to the contract programme.

Carbon Neutral for direct emissions; targeting Net Zero carbon by 2030
Certified offsetting programme aligned with PAS2080 carbon management and ISO20400 responsible procurement
Measuring biodiversity net gain on all projects; delivering on- and off‑site habitat enhancements
Social value target: delivering social value equivalent to 30% of turnover in 2023/24 (up from 20% in 2022/23)
178 people‑hours spent on environment improvement; 113.62 MTCDE greenhouse gas reduction since April 2023
